Overview

Medium pressure fans are mechanical devices designed to move air or gases at moderate pressure levels, typically ranging from 1,000 to 10,000 Pa. They are widely used in industrial settings, HVAC systems, and ventilation applications where consistent airflow is required. These fans are engineered to balance efficiency and durability, making them suitable for continuous operation in demanding environments. Unlike low-pressure fans, medium pressure fans can handle higher resistance in duct systems, making them ideal for applications where air needs to be pushed or pulled through filters, heat exchangers, or long duct runs. Their versatility and reliability have made them a staple in industries such as manufacturing, mining, and commercial building management.

Structure and Working Principle

A medium pressure fan typically consists of a housing, impeller, motor, and sometimes additional components like dampers or silencers. The impeller, often made of steel or aluminum, rotates at high speeds to create airflow. The motor provides the necessary power, and the housing directs the airflow efficiently. The working principle involves the impeller blades accelerating air outward due to centrifugal force, creating a pressure difference that moves air through the system. The design of the impeller and housing determines the fan's efficiency and pressure capabilities. Some models feature backward-curved blades for higher efficiency, while others use forward-curved blades for compact designs.

Key Features

Medium pressure fans are known for their robust construction, often featuring corrosion-resistant materials for longevity. Many models include energy-efficient motors and aerodynamic impeller designs to minimize power consumption while maintaining performance. Noise reduction features, such as insulated housings or vibration dampers, are common in units designed for commercial or residential use. Another key feature is the ability to handle varying loads, making them adaptable to different system requirements. Some advanced models come with variable speed drives (VSDs) or automated controls to adjust airflow based on demand, further enhancing energy efficiency and operational flexibility.

Application Areas

These fans are extensively used in industrial ventilation systems to remove fumes, dust, or heat from manufacturing processes. In HVAC systems, they ensure proper air circulation in large buildings, maintaining indoor air quality and comfort. They are also employed in air handling units (AHUs) for commercial and institutional buildings. Other applications include drying processes in food processing plants, exhaust systems in mining operations, and pneumatic conveying systems in material handling. Their ability to operate under moderate pressure makes them suitable for systems where air needs to be transported over longer distances or through restrictive components like filters or heat exchangers.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ance and longevity of medium pressure fans. This includes periodic cleaning of impellers and housings to prevent dust buildup, lubrication of bearings, and inspection of belts (if applicable). Vibration levels should be monitored, as excessive vibration can indicate misalignment or wear. Precautions include ensuring proper installation to avoid strain on components, maintaining clearances around the fan for adequate airflow, and protecting electrical components from moisture. Overloading the fan beyond its rated capacity should be avoided, as this can lead to motor burnout or mechanical failure. Always follow manufacturer guidelines for operation and maintenance.

B2B Procurement Guide

When procuring medium pressure fans for business use, consider the specific airflow and pressure requirements of your application. Evaluate the fan's efficiency rating, as this impacts long-term operating costs. Material selection is important for compatibility with the operating environment, especially in corrosive or high-temperature conditions. Look for suppliers with a proven track record in industrial applications and check for certifications like ISO standards. Consider after-sales support, including availability of spare parts and technical assistance. For large-scale purchases, negotiate volume discounts and inquire about customization options to meet your exact specifications.
